Flammable, toxic, corrosive, oxygen, cryogenic
If a gas cylinder or gas piping begins to leak or is suspected of leaking, thereby presenting danger to building occupants, proceed as follows:
- Immediately notify building occupants to evacuate the area along the established route.
- Notify MSU Police at 911. If there is no answer, or if the line is busy, call 2222 to report the details of the chemical emergency.
- Ensure that HVAC (heating, ventilation, air conditioning) for the building is shut down. Avoid open flames. This may require a call to Facilities Management at 4291 or 4391.
Be prepared to provide the following information:
- Building name
- Building location
- Floor number
- Room number
- Specific chemical name of the involved gas
- Estimated volume of gas
- Make every attempt to direct evacuating personnel away from the hazardous area. Account for all building occupants at the designated meeting area. Building occupants should not return until instructed to do so by the building emergency coordinator, department chair or MSU Police personnel.
